What are the advantages and disadvantages of ultrasound?
Advantages of Ultrasound:
- Non-invasive: Ultrasound imaging does not involve the use of radiation like X-rays or CT scans, making it safer for patients, especially during pregnancy.
- Real-time imaging: Ultrasound provides dynamic, real-time images that allow doctors to observe anatomical structures, organ functions, and blood flow patterns in motion. This helps in diagnosing and monitoring medical conditions in real-time.
- Portable: Ultrasound machines are relatively compact and portable, allowing for easier access to medical imaging in various settings, including clinics, hospitals, and emergency departments.
- Versatile: Ultrasound can be used to visualize a wide range of body tissues, including soft tissues, organs, blood vessels, and muscles, making it a versatile tool for diagnosing a variety of medical conditions.
- Cost-effective: Ultrasound is generally more cost-effective than other imaging modalities, such as MRI or CT scans.
Disadvantages of Ultrasound:
- Limited tissue penetration: Ultrasound waves cannot penetrate dense tissue or bone, which may limit its effectiveness in imaging certain areas of the body.
- Operator-dependent: The quality of ultrasound images highly depends on the skill and experience of the sonographer performing the scan. Interpretation of ultrasound images requires specialized training and expertise.
- Artifacts and limitations: Ultrasound images can be affected by various factors, such as overlying structures, gas bubbles, or acoustic shadows, which can sometimes obscure or distort the underlying tissue.
- Patient discomfort: Some ultrasound examinations may require patients to hold uncomfortable positions for extended periods, leading to potential discomfort.
- Certain conditions may not be detectable: Some medical conditions or abnormalities may not be easily detectable or visible using ultrasound, which may necessitate the use of alternative imaging techniques.
